7 Postpartum Training Myths Every New Mom Needs to Know”
Google search "postpartum fitness", and you'll be bombarded with the pressure of tips, quick fixes, and health hacks that leave us feeling less than enough because we're not bouncing back fast enough.
But God didn’t design your body to “bounce back.” He created it to heal, restore, and grow stronger. In this episode, we’re busting 7 postpartum training myths that Christian moms are often told—and replacing them with hope-filled, body-wise truths rooted in science and compassion.
You'll learn ...
✅ The truth about 6-week clearance (and why healing doesn’t follow a calendar)
✅ Why cardio + weight loss shouldn’t be your first step—and what to do instead
✅ How body composition impacts long-term health (not just how you look)
✅ What Scripture and science both affirm about rest, restoration, and movement
✅ Specific strength strategies for postpartum recovery—no shame, no hustle
